Question to the Department for Work and Pensions:
To ask the Minister for Women and Equalities, what plans the Government has to strengthen protections in the Equality Act 2010 for people with mental health problems who experience discrimination.
Tacking mental health discrimination in the workplace is a priority for the Government. We are considering the scope for further support and protection for people with mental health conditions.
The Equality Act 2010 already protects people whose mental health conditions meet the definition of disability in the Act, specifically a physical or mental impairment that has a ‘substantial and long-term adverse effect on a person’s ability to carry out normal day to day activities’.
